According to an anonymous juror, after two days taking in testimony in the Anthony Nicodemo murder trial, she surmised the shooting was a mob hit
By George Anastasia
She listened to two days of testimony in the Anthony Nicodemo murder trial last month and said she wasn’t buying the defense argument that Nicodemo was carjacked and became an unwitting getaway driver in the murder of Gino DiPietro.
“The story about the carjacking was absurd,” the former Common Pleas Court panelist wrote in one of several e-mail exchanges with Bigtrial.net. She also said she surmised the shooting was a mob hit even though the judge had barred any mention of organized crime.
